Wow it sounds like Charlie is doing just great! (Love his name by the way!).

If I could just give one small piece of advice it would be to not hand feed him... Of course he prefers it because he already loves his new mommy . But you don't want to let him train you to do that... It will get very tiring for you at mealtimes!
